Frequently Asked Questions about the 91910 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 91910?

There are currently 192 Studio Apartments in 91910 with rent ranges from $740 to $2,950 with an average price of $2,056.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 91910 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 91910 ranges from $1,195 to $4,499 with an average monthly rent of $2,318.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 91910 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 91910 range from $1,650 to $5,540.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,855.

How expensive are 91910 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 81 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 91910 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,500 to $7,266 - averaging $3,596 for the location.
